Fuqua Elementary School auction to benefit Red Cross

TERRE HAUTE — Fuqua Elementary School invites the public to attend their annual Charity Auction. This year’s auction proceeds will go to support the American Red Cross Wabash Valley Chapter.

The event will take place on Nov. 10 in the school’s gymnasium.

Food, drinks and browsing begin at 6 p.m. with the live auction beginning at 6:45 p.m.

There will be door prizes and both a live auction and a silent auction.
